TRP channels are cation channels involved in pain perception and thermosensation [47]. TRPV1 is activated by many stimuli, such as heat (>42 °C), vanilloids, lipids, and protons/cations. Quite a few extremely selective TRPV1 antagonists are at the moment in medical progress for your treatment method of pain. Even though the utilization of desensitizing TRPV1 agonists decreases pain sensitivity [forty eight,forty nine], latest clinical trials have demonstrated that blocking TRPV1 also affects entire body temperature. This unfortunate aspect influence has halted Considerably with the drug advancement activity concentrating on this channel. Topical software, even so, has become revealed for being helpful in preventing the Preliminary pain flare-up that happens with agonist-induced nociceptor excitation ahead of desensitization. TRPM8 is activated in vitro by cold temperatures (ten–23 °C) and cooling agents which include icilin and menthol. Researchers have a short while ago discovered the TRPM8 antagonist 15 makes an analgesic effect in experimental styles of cold pain in humans without affecting Main human body temperature [fifty].

PG is produced from your AA through the catalysis of COX. They are available in other tissue in our bodies and they are considered as an archetypal sensitizing agent that lessens the nociceptive threshold as well as the core reason behind tenderness. PGE2 (made by cyclooxygenase-two) and prostacyclin (PGI2) (made by cyclooxygenase-one) are two key prostaglandins that cause a immediate afferent sensitization. The receptor of PGE2 may be divided into 4 significant forms, for example prostaglandin E2 receptor variety 1–four (EP1–four), whereas the receptor of PGI2 is termed prostacyclin receptor (IP).

For such a pain, the region of analyze concentrates totally on the afferent component as it's been demonstrated the administration of some pharmaceuticals, such as nearby anesthetics, can alleviate ongoing neuropathic pain [157]. The continued afferent action might act in alternative ways in order to induce variations in transduction. The mechanisms can vary and may contain the expression of transducers in neurons that Usually usually do not express this type of transducer, the increase in expression of excitatory receptors [158], and/or even the minimize of inhibitory transducers [159]. A different system will be the expression of thermal or mechanical transducers close to the extremity in the Reduce, broken axon [159], or In the ganglia [160]. It can be plausible to hypothesize that the different procedures arise and collaborate at the same time to lead to the continuing activity within the afferents afflicted through nerve injury. The origins on the activity may possibly contain, as previously described, the ectopic expression of transducers [161]. One illustration will be the anomalous activation of nociceptors by norepinephrine which ends up in the sympathetic put up-ganglionic terminals that are expressed on ganglia [162] plus the alteration in expression and density of ion channels that contributes to instability and spontaneous exercise on the membrane [163]. These mechanisms of exercise are not simply a consequence of your destruction but are likely to become a results of the various modifications that happen as time passes. For these reasons, neuropathic pain is challenging to manage.
